THREE PEOPLE were hospitalised following a two-car collision in Scarawalsh, with one suffering from serious injuries.
The crash, which took place after 4 p.m yesterday, caused the closure of the N11 road for several hours with a huge disruption to traffic.
The road closed following the collision until roughly 9 p.m, as fire brigade personnel worked to clear the debris from the vehicles and Gardaí carried out a technical investigation.
The injured parties were taken to Wexford General Hospital with one treated for serious injuries, although they were not said to be life-threatening.
The cause for the incident, which happened on a straight road with excellent driving conditions, is unclear, but Gardaí are investigating the matter.
All witnesses are asked to contact Enniscorthy Garda Station with any information they may have.
